Pistol Day Parade To Tour With Ted Nugent

PISTOL CROP 

Tour Kicks Off July 8 at The Celebrity Theatre in Phoenix

 

Pistol Day Parade ~ Fuller, Rob Banks, Guido, Jason Lollio, Jason Hartless ~ has announced that they will be touring as direct support to Ted Nugent.  The string of dates begins at the Celebrity Theatre in Phoenix on July 8 and will wrap on August 14 at the House of Blues in Houston.  The band will also be playing 3 shows at Sturgis Buffalo Chip appearing on the Main stage and the Crossroads stage Aug 7-9 and will make additional headline appearances, including July 4 & 5 at the Iron Coffin Rally in Erie, MI.

On touring with the one and only Ted Nugent, Pistol Day Parade’s guitarist Rob Banks shared, “When I was 8 years old my Uncle Kenny gave me my first guitar.  My dad turned me on to Nugent when I was 9, and I went to my First Whiplash Bash.  We went 10 years in a row until Ted stopped staging the event, but continued to attend everything Ted!  I attended the Ted Nugent camp for kids, with my zebra striped guitar in hand which I had Ted sign along with my bow.  To play my first major tour as direct support for Ted Nugent is fate at its best.  When asked in interviews about my idols, he stands alone at the top of that list.  I still have my zebra guitar, and it’s coming with us on the road.” 

PDP sturgisLooking towards the band’s first visit to Sturgis, Banks said, “I wanted to ride my ’78 Kawasaki to Sturgis, but the guys said it looked funny with my guitar and amp strapped on my back with some chords dragging behind me.  I’m psyched to finally get to Sturgis.  When we’re on stage, I get that same adrenaline rush as when you riding a Harley on a beautiful day with the bugs hitting your face.”

PDP at HOBTriumphing over the tough economic circumstances of the Detroit area, Pistol Day Parade is regarded as one of the top rising rock acts in the country, already earning endorsements from the likes of Dream Cymbals and Gongs, Spector Basses, and Eilxir Strings. Their debut EP, She Wants More, recorded by Mike Brown (Velvet Revolver, Breaking Benjamin) has sold close to 10,000 physical copies and thousands more digitally. The track “Rockstar’s Girlfriend” debuted at #38 on Billboard’s Active Rock charts, reaching #1 at the band’s hometown rock radio station and format leader WRIF – Detroit.  The follow-up demo single “High” was a significant hit on Midwestern rock radio and received major airplay.  Fueled by this traction in the industry, the band staged countless shows at Detroit’s famous Fillmore Theater, proving each time that while they are thrilled to be hometown stars, they are destined to be stars in the eyes (and ears) of  nationwide and likely international audience.  Being asked to support Ted Nugent speaks to what the future holds for Pistol Day Parade, as do their past supporting positions for Stone Temple Pilots, Ice-T, Tesla, and dozens of other established artists.

PDP BurnPistol Day Parade is signed to Goomba Records, which released the band’s full-length debut Burn in 2013.  The album was produced by Tim Patalan (Sponge, Lovedrug) at The Loft Studios in Saline, Michigan.  Rock radio giant WRIF – Detroit took the lead single “Better” to #1 at the station, and the follow-up single “Not Today” went to #2 on the station’s playlist.
